#Video shows gunman fire into NYC apartment

Police are looking for a man who opened fire at an occupied apartment in Queens early Sunday morning.

The shooter was caught on surveillance camera firing two bullets at the Jackson Heights building near 91st Street and 35th Avenue just before 4 a.m., according to cops.

One of the bullets pierced a window and became lodged in the ceiling of an apartment that had three people inside, cops said.

The other bullet struck the outside of the building. Nobody was injured, police said.

It was not immediately clear if the shooter was targeting the apartment, cops said. Two women, ages 23 and 25, and a 20-year-old man were inside at the time.
